I have
HARDWARECLOCK="UTC"
TIMEZONE="right/Portugal"
in /etc/rc.conf, but I'm not sure this is the right thing to do. I use
clockspeed to keep the clock synchronized with a ntp server, and other
sofware requires a "right/*" timezone. Anyone has any knowledge to share
about this issue?  For example, "date" gives output that ignores leap
seconds. Is this a date issue, unrelated with rc.conf? Anyone else using
a right/* timezone?
